http://hl7.org/fhir/StructureDefinition/Device|4.0.1

A type of a manufactured item that is used in the provision of healthcare without being substantially changed through that activity. The device may be a medical or non-medical device.
NameFlagsCardTypeDescription & Constraints
Device
0..*Item used in healthcare
 
identifier
0..*IdentifierInstance identifier
 
definition
0..1ReferenceThe reference to the definition for the device
 
udiCarrier
Σ
0..*BackboneElementUnique Device Identifier (UDI) Barcode string
 
 
deviceIdentifier
Σ
0..1stringMandatory fixed portion of UDI
 
 
issuer
0..1uriUDI Issuing Organization
 
 
jurisdiction
0..1uriRegional UDI authority
 
 
carrierAIDC
Σ
0..1base64BinaryUDI Machine Readable Barcode String
 
 
carrierHRF
Σ
0..1stringUDI Human Readable Barcode String
 
 
entryType
0..1codebarcode | rfid | manual + UDIEntryType (required)
 
status
?!Σ
0..1codeactive | inactive | entered-in-error | unknown FHIRDeviceStatus (required)
 
statusReason
0..*CodeableConceptonline | paused | standby | offline | not-ready | transduc-discon | hw-discon | off FHIRDeviceStatusReason (extensible)
 
distinctIdentifier
0..1stringThe distinct identification string
 
manufacturer
0..1stringName of device manufacturer
 
manufactureDate
0..1dateTimeDate when the device was made
 
expirationDate
0..1dateTimeDate and time of expiry of this device (if applicable)
 
lotNumber
0..1stringLot number of manufacture
 
serialNumber
0..1stringSerial number assigned by the manufacturer
 
deviceName
0..*BackboneElementThe name of the device as given by the manufacturer
 
 
name *
1..1stringThe name of the device
 
 
type *
1..1codeudi-label-name | user-friendly-name | patient-reported-name | manufacturer-name | model-name | other DeviceNameType (required)
 
modelNumber
0..1stringThe model number for the device
 
partNumber
0..1stringThe part number of the device
 
type
0..1CodeableConceptThe kind or type of device DeviceType (example)
 
specialization
0..*BackboneElementThe capabilities supported on a device, the standards to which the device conforms for a particular purpose, and used for the communication
 
 
systemType *
1..1CodeableConceptThe standard that is used to operate and communicate
 
 
version
0..1stringThe version of the standard that is used to operate and communicate
 
version
0..*BackboneElementThe actual design of the device or software version running on the device
 
 
type
0..1CodeableConceptThe type of the device version
 
 
component
0..1IdentifierA single component of the device version
 
 
value *
1..1stringThe version text
 
property
0..*BackboneElementThe actual configuration settings of a device as it actually operates, e.g., regulation status, time properties
 
 
type *
1..1CodeableConceptCode that specifies the property DeviceDefinitionPropetyCode (Extensible)
 
 
valueQuantity
0..*QuantityProperty value as a quantity
 
 
valueCode
0..*CodeableConceptProperty value as a code, e.g., NTP4 (synced to NTP)
 
patient
0..1ReferencePatient to whom Device is affixed
 
owner
0..1ReferenceOrganization responsible for device
 
contact
0..*ContactPointDetails for human/organization for support
 
location
0..1ReferenceWhere the device is found
 
url
0..1uriNetwork address to contact device
 
note
0..*AnnotationDevice notes and comments
 
safety
Σ
0..*CodeableConceptSafety Characteristics of Device
 
parent
0..1ReferenceThe parent device